White blood cells (WBCs) are more resistant to lysis than red blood cells (RBCs). When looking at a sample of blood for WBCs, what could you do to reduce interference from RBCs?
◦ Mix the blood in a hypertonic solution, which will cause the RBCs to lyse.
◦ Mix the blood in a salty solution to cause the RBCs to lyse.
◦ Mix the blood in a hypotonic solution, which will cause the RBCs to lyse.
◦ Mix the blood in an isotonic solution and allow the WBCs to float to the top.

When taking monoamine oxidase inhibitors, people should avoid a variety of foods, which include alcoholic beverages, bean curd, broad (fava) bean pods, cheese, fish, ginseng, protein extracts, meat, sauerkraut, shrimp paste, soups, and yeast.

The liver is the only organ that has the ability to regenerate itself after certain types of damage. As much as 25% of the liver can be removed, and it will still regenerate back to its original shape and size. However, the liver cannot regenerate after severe damage caused by alcohol.
